What is OBRA 90'?
An act that specifically states that a pharmacist must counsel all Medicaid patients who receive new prescriptions
What are the 3 DUE alerts required under OBRA 90'?
1. Possible Drug interactions
2. Contraindications
3. Appropriateness of dosage and duration of therapy

Explain stock rotation
when items with the earliest expiration date is moved to the front so they are used first
Name 3 valid reasons that a medication can be returned to the warehouse?
1. Drug damaged during delivery
2. Drug is expired or expiring
3. Drug was recalled
A patient has Valsartan in their medication profile and they bring in a new prescription for Olmsartan, what DUE ALERT will you see?
Duplicate Therapy
A patient has high blood pressure and was prescribed a nasal decongestant, what DUE ALERT may pop up?
Drug to disease interaction
A 6 year old patient was prescribed 20ml b.i.d of medication A with codeine, what DUE ALERT may you see?
Dug to Age precaution
